    The Benefits: Why Use a Diesel Additive?

    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ty. Why should you consider using a John Deere diesel additive? The advantages are numerous, and the potential for savings and improved performance is significant. Here are some key benefits:

    • Improved Fuel Efficiency: One of the most immediate benefits is enhanced fuel economy. Additives help to ensure that fuel burns more completely, which means you get more power from every drop. This translates to lower fuel consumption and reduced operating costs. Over time, these savings can really add up, especially if you have a fleet of machines.
    • Reduced Emissions: Diesel engines are known for their emissions, but additives can help mitigate this. Many additives reduce the amount of harmful pollutants released into the environment, making your equipment more eco-friendly. This is not only good for the planet but also helps you comply with increasingly strict environmental regulations. The cleaner your exhaust, the better for everyone involved.
    • Enhanced Engine Performance: Additives can boost your engine's power and responsiveness. They clean fuel injectors, prevent the build-up of deposits, and reduce friction between moving parts. This results in smoother operation, improved acceleration, and overall better performance, especially when tackling tough jobs.
    • Protection Against Wear and Tear: Diesel engines are tough, but they still need protection. Additives can prevent corrosion and reduce wear on critical components, extending the lifespan of your engine. This is particularly important for expensive parts like fuel injectors and pumps. By preventing premature wear, you can avoid costly repairs and replacements down the road.
    • Cold Weather Performance: Some additives are specifically designed to improve cold-weather performance. They prevent fuel gelling, ensuring your engine starts reliably even in freezing temperatures. This is a game-changer for those who operate their equipment in cold climates. No more struggling to start your engine on those chilly mornings!
    • Fuel System Cleaning: Over time, deposits can build up in your fuel system, leading to reduced performance and potential damage. Additives help to clean these deposits, keeping your fuel system operating at its best. Clean fuel injectors are critical for efficient fuel delivery and optimal engine performance.

    Types of John Deere Diesel Additives

    Okay, so we know why to use a diesel additive, but which one should you choose? John Deere offers a range of additives designed to meet various needs and operating conditions. Let's take a look at some of the most popular types:

    • John Deere Premium Diesel Fuel Conditioner: This is a general-purpose additive designed for year-round use. It cleans fuel injectors, reduces emissions, and improves fuel economy. It also provides corrosion protection and helps prevent fuel gelling in cold weather. This is an excellent choice for general maintenance and overall engine health.
    • John Deere Cold Weather Fuel Additive: As the name suggests, this additive is specifically designed for cold-weather operation. It prevents fuel gelling, ensuring that your engine starts reliably in freezing temperatures. It also contains detergents and corrosion inhibitors for added protection. If you live in a cold climate or operate your equipment during winter, this is a must-have.
    • John Deere Diesel Fuel Stabilizer: If you store your equipment for extended periods, a fuel stabilizer is essential. It prevents fuel degradation and keeps the fuel fresh, ensuring that your engine starts and runs smoothly when you're ready to use it again. This helps prevent the formation of sludge and varnish, which can clog fuel systems and cause starting problems.
    • John Deere Diesel Injector Cleaner: This is a concentrated additive designed to clean fuel injectors and remove deposits. It's ideal for engines that are experiencing reduced performance or have been running on poor-quality fuel. Regular use can prevent injector problems and maintain optimal fuel delivery. Cleaning fuel injectors is critical to maintain good performance.

    How to Use John Deere Diesel Additives

    Using a John Deere diesel additive is super easy, but here are some best practices for maximizing its effectiveness. Following these steps will help you get the most out of your additive and ensure optimal engine performance.

    1. Read the Instructions: Always start by reading the instructions on the additive's packaging. The recommended dosage and application methods may vary depending on the product. Following the manufacturer's instructions is crucial for achieving the desired results.
    2. Add to the Fuel Tank: Add the additive directly to your fuel tank before refueling. This ensures that the additive mixes thoroughly with the fuel. Make sure you use the correct dosage, following the product's instructions.
    3. Refuel: After adding the additive, refuel your tank with fresh diesel fuel. This helps to distribute the additive throughout the fuel system. This ensures that the additive is mixed well and ready to work when you start your engine.
    4. Run the Engine: Start your engine and let it run for a few minutes to allow the additive to circulate through the fuel system. This helps the additive to reach all the critical components and start working its magic. After you are done adding the additive, run your engine to help circulate the additive.
    5. Regular Use: For optimal results, use the additive regularly, following the manufacturer's recommendations. Many additives are designed for use with every fill-up, while others are recommended at specific intervals. Consistent use will ensure that your engine remains clean and protected, leading to long-term benefits. Regular use is the key to enjoying all of the benefits that a John Deere additive can provide.
    6. Storage: Store your additives in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ures. Properly stored additives will maintain their effectiveness for longer periods. This ensures the additive stays effective for the long run.
